乒乓球运动参数检测方法、装置及乒乓球训练辅助系统制造方法及图纸

技术编号:33795046 阅读:15 留言:0更新日期:2022-06-12 14:56
本申请涉及一种乒乓球运动参数检测方法、装置及乒乓球训练辅助系统,所述方法包括:通过高速摄像机拍摄乒乓球在运动过程中的乒乓球桌面图像并识别出乒乓球图像;从乒乓球图像上识别出设置在乒乓球表面的单色色斑图像,并确定单色色斑的颜色及其相对于乒乓球图像的分布位置;分别根据各个颜色的单色色斑图像的分布位置计算单色色斑在乒乓球三维坐标系上的第一三维坐标值,并在该帧乒乓球桌面图像上关联;获取若干帧相邻的乒乓球桌面图像,根据各帧乒乓球桌面图像上关联的颜色及其第一三维坐标值计算乒乓球的旋转方向及其旋转角速度。该技术方案,可以降低图像处理数据量,减少高速摄像机的使用数量,降低高速摄像机的帧率要求,提升检测效率。提升检测效率。提升检测效率。

【技术实现步骤摘要】
乒乓球运动参数检测方法、装置及乒乓球训练辅助系统


[0001]本申请涉及体育科技
,尤其是一种乒乓球运动参数检测方法、装置及乒乓球训练辅助系统。

技术介绍

[0002]在乒乓球辅助训练过程中,通过乒乓球训练辅助系统准确地检测乒乓球运动参数,在极短的时间内完成计算,准确的识别、定位和跟踪高速运动的乒乓球飞行轨迹等等,对于指导运动员进行训练具有重要意义;乒乓球运动参数包括运动轨迹、运动速度以及旋转角速度,特别是乒乓球在运动过程中产生的快速旋转运动,据统计,专业的乒乓球运动员打出的旋转球转速可达50 转/ 秒以上,在如此高转速下,一般是通过高速摄像机实时捕捉到相邻图像帧之间乒乓球的细小运动变化,计算乒乓球的旋转角速度。
[0003]当前,有技术是通过拍摄并识别乒乓球的标记(如球标),结合平面坐标系的夹角识别旋转方向,再根据角度差与时间间隔计算乒乓球的旋转角速度。另外,由于乒乓球的标记在高速摄像机的阴影区旋转时无法被拍摄到,由此可能导致无法检测情况,为了解决这个问题,常用方法是同时使用至少两台高速摄像机进行图像采集,从而保证乒乓球上的标识始终存在于高速摄像机的视野中。
[0004]由于乒乓球是表面是圆形的,在高速摄像机拍摄图片中,前后两帧图像的检测点之间距离较近时才能准确检测旋转路径,这就要求高速摄像机必须要使用帧率较高的高速摄像机,需要处理大量的图像数据,计算相当复杂,对摄像设备和图像数据处理设备的要求较高,影响了检测效率;而且,为了避免上述阴影区的影响需要配备两个以上的摄像头,导致高速摄像机的设备成本上升,使得这些辅助系统设备难以在体育训练中推广应用,影响了乒乓球训练辅助系统的训练辅助效果。

技术实现思路

[0005]针对于上述技术缺陷之一,本申请提供一种乒乓球运动参数检测方法、装置及乒乓球训练辅助系统,降低图像数据处理量、减少高速摄像机的使用数量以及提升检测效率。
[0006]第一方面:本申请提供一种乒乓球运动参数检测方法,包括:通过设于乒乓球桌上方一设定高度的高速摄像机拍摄乒乓球在运动过程中的乒乓球桌面图像,对所述乒乓球桌面图像的各个图像帧进行分析识别出乒乓球图像;从所述乒乓球图像上识别出设置在乒乓球表面的单色色斑图像,并确定所述单色色斑的颜色及其相对于所述乒乓球图像的分布位置;其中,所述单色色斑设置在乒乓球表面上,且位于乒乓球内置正四面体顶点位置处;分别根据各个颜色的单色色斑图像的分布位置计算所述单色色斑在乒乓球三维坐标系上的第一三维坐标值,并在该帧乒乓球桌面图像上关联相应的颜色及其第一三维坐标值;其中,所述乒乓球三维坐标系是以乒乓球球心为原点的三维坐标系;
获取若干帧相邻的乒乓球桌面图像,根据各帧乒乓球桌面图像上关联的颜色及其第一三维坐标值计算乒乓球的旋转方向及其旋转角速度。
[0007]第二方面:本申请提供一种乒乓球运动参数检测装置,包括:图像获取模块,用于通过设于乒乓球桌上方一设定高度的高速摄像机拍摄乒乓球在运动过程中的乒乓球桌面图像,对所述乒乓球桌面图像的各个图像帧进行分析识别出乒乓球图像;位置确定模块,用于从所述乒乓球图像上识别出设置在乒乓球表面的单色色斑图像,并确定所述单色色斑的颜色及其相对于所述乒乓球图像的分布位置;其中,所述单色色斑设置在乒乓球表面上,且位于乒乓球内置正四面体顶点位置处;坐标关联模块,用于分别根据各个颜色的单色色斑图像的分布位置计算所述单色色斑在乒乓球三维坐标系上的第一三维坐标值,并在该帧乒乓球桌面图像上关联相应的颜色及其第一三维坐标值;其中,所述乒乓球三维坐标系是以乒乓球球心为原点的三维坐标系;参数计算模块,用于获取若干帧相邻的乒乓球桌面图像,根据各帧乒乓球桌面图像上关联的颜色及其第一三维坐标值计算乒乓球的旋转方向及其旋转角速度。
[0008]第三方面:本申请提供一种乒乓球训练辅助系统,包括:分布设置于各个乒乓球桌面上方的高速摄像机,姿态摄像头,内置于各个乒乓球拍的传感装置,以及后台服务器;所述高速摄像机、传感装置、姿态摄像头和接触感应面板通过无线网络设备连接至所述后台服务器;所述传感装置包括:加速度传感器、粘贴在乒乓球拍的胶皮上的触摸感应层以及MCU和无线通讯模块;其中,所述加速度传感器和连接至MCU,所述MCU通过所述无线通讯模块连接至后台服务器;所述姿态摄像头用于拍摄球员的实时图像,并根据所述实时图像获取所述球员的运动姿态数据发送至所述后台服务器;所述后台服务器被配置为执行所述的乒乓球运动参数检测方法的步骤,以及执行如下步骤:接收所述加速度传感器检测的乒乓球拍的加速度数据,接收所述触摸感应层检测的乒乓球接触拍面的击发位置数据,接收球员的运动姿态数据;根据所述乒乓球的旋转方向及其旋转角速度、乒乓球拍的加速度数据、击发位置数据、球员的运动姿态数据进行数据分析,并根据分析结果生成辅助训练参考信息。
[0009]上述乒乓球运动参数检测方法、装置及乒乓球训练辅助系统,首先在位于乒乓球内置正四面体顶点位置处的乒乓球的表面上设置单色色斑,在检测过程中,通过乒乓球桌上方的高速摄像机,拍摄乒乓球桌面图像并识别乒乓球图像,然后从乒乓球图像上识别出单色色斑图像,检测出单色色斑的颜色及其相对于乒乓球图像的分布位置;再分别根据各个颜色的单色色斑图像的分布位置计算出单色色斑在乒乓球三维坐标系上的三维坐标值并与乒乓球桌面图像进行关联,最后通过若干帧相邻的乒乓球桌面图像,利用其根据各帧乒乓球桌面图像上关联的颜色及其三维坐标值来计算出乒乓球的旋转方向及其旋转角速度。该技术方案,通过在位于乒乓球内置正四面体顶点位置处的乒乓球的表面上设置单色
色斑,一方面通过单色色斑有利于图像识别处理,从而可以降低图像处理数据量,另一方面,由于是乒乓球内置正四面体顶点位置处设置单色色斑,通过至少一个单色色斑即可以确定其他单色色斑的三维坐标位置;由此可以确保不管乒乓球如何旋转,至少会有一个单色色斑会被高速摄像机拍摄到,即使部分单色色斑处于高速摄像机的阴影区,每一帧乒乓球图像都能够确保有单色色斑被检测到,从而减少高速摄像机的使用数量;通过将一维标记信息识别过程分解到多维标记信息识别过程,将短时间的识别过程变换为长时间的识别过程,由此也可以极大地降低对于高速摄像机的帧率要求,提升检测效率。
[0010]进一步的,在实现了基于单个高速摄像机来进行检测乒乓球的旋转方向及其旋转角速度基础上,还可以检测出乒乓球的运动轨迹,并利用加速度数据、击发位置数据、运动姿态数据等进行数据分析,根据分析结果生成辅助训练参考信息。
[0011]本申请附加的方面和优点将在下面的描述中部分给出,这些将从下面的描述中变得明显,或通过本申请的实践了解到。
附图说明
[0012]本申请上述的和/或附加的方面和优点从下面结合附图对实施例的描述中将变得明显和容易理解,其中:图1是一个实施例的乒乓球运动参数检测方法流程图;图2是一个示例的高速摄像机安装位置示意图;图3是一个示例乒乓球表面设置单色色斑示意图;图4是一个示例的识别单色色斑的分布位置示意图;图5是一个示例的乒乓球三维坐标系示意图本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种乒乓球运动参数检测方法,其特征在于,包括:通过设于乒乓球桌上方一设定高度的高速摄像机拍摄乒乓球在运动过程中的乒乓球桌面图像,对所述乒乓球桌面图像的各个图像帧进行分析识别出乒乓球图像;从所述乒乓球图像上识别出设置在乒乓球表面的单色色斑图像,并确定所述单色色斑的颜色及其相对于所述乒乓球图像的分布位置;其中,所述单色色斑设置在乒乓球表面上,且位于乒乓球内置正四面体顶点位置处;分别根据各个颜色的单色色斑图像的分布位置计算所述单色色斑在乒乓球三维坐标系上的第一三维坐标值,并在该帧乒乓球桌面图像上关联相应的颜色及其第一三维坐标值;其中,所述乒乓球三维坐标系是以乒乓球球心为原点的三维坐标系;获取若干帧相邻的乒乓球桌面图像,根据各帧乒乓球桌面图像上关联的颜色及其第一三维坐标值计算乒乓球的旋转方向及其旋转角速度。2.根据权利要求1所述的乒乓球运动参数检测方法,其特征在于,所述从所述乒乓球图像上识别出设置在乒乓球表面的单色色斑图像,并确定所述单色色斑的颜色及其相对于所述乒乓球图像的分布位置的步骤,包括:根据预设的各种颜色的颜色范围阈值对所述乒乓球图像范围内的像素颜色值进行判断,确定所述乒乓球图像上的各个单色色斑图像及其对应的颜色;获取各个颜色的单色色斑图像所在的像素区域,确定所述像素区域的中心位置,作为单色色斑的中心位置;计算所述中心位置与所述乒乓球图像中心的相对位置参数;其中,所述相对位置参数为所述中心位置在乒乓球图像中心为原点的乒乓球切面坐标系上的二维坐标值;根据所述相对位置参数得到所述单色色斑图像相对于所述乒乓球图像的分布位置。3.根据权利要求2所述的乒乓球运动参数检测方法,其特征在于,所述分别根据各个颜色的单色色斑图像的分布位置计算所述单色色斑在乒乓球三维坐标系上的第一三维坐标值,并在该帧乒乓球桌面图像上关联相应的颜色及其第一三维坐标值的步骤,包括:以所述乒乓球球心为原点构建乒乓球三维坐标系;其中,所述乒乓球三维坐标系的xy轴平面平行于乒乓球桌面平面,z轴垂直于乒乓球球心;根据所述乒乓球图像在所述乒乓球桌面图像中的分布位置以及所述设定高度确定高速摄像机与乒乓球球心的摄像夹角;根据所述摄像夹角以及所述二维坐标值计算所述单色色斑在所述乒乓球三维坐标系上的第一三维坐标值;在所述乒乓球桌面图像上关联记录所识别的颜色和所述单色色斑的第一三维坐标值。4.根据权利要求3所述的乒乓球运动参数检测方法,其特征在于,所述高速摄像机设于乒乓球桌中网中心的正上方一设定高度位置处;所述根据所述乒乓球图像在所述乒乓球桌面图像中的分布位置以及所述设定高度确定高速摄像机与乒乓球球心的摄像夹角的步骤,包括:获取乒乓球图像的中心位置以及所述乒乓球桌面图像的中网中点位置;根据所述乒乓球图像的中心位置和所述乒乓球桌面图像的中网中点位置确定乒乓球球心相对于所述乒乓球桌面的中网中点之间的第一距离;根据所述第一距离及所述设定高度计算所述高速摄像机与乒乓球球心之间的摄像夹
角。5.根据权利要求4所述的乒乓球运动参数检测方法,其特征在于,所述获取若干帧相邻的乒乓球桌面图像,根据各帧乒乓球桌面图像上关联的颜色及其第一三维坐标值计算乒乓球的旋转方向及其旋转角速度的步骤,包括:选取连续的若干帧所述乒乓球桌面图像作为待分析图像帧;其中,所述待分析图像帧至少包括同一种颜色重复出现的多个图像帧;分别从所述待分析图像帧中识别出各种颜色所包含的图像帧,形成以颜色为类型的待分析图像帧分组;针对于不同颜色类型,利用所述待分析图像帧...

【专利技术属性】
技术研发人员:江炬
申请(专利权)人:广州精天信息科技股份有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1